Scaffolding provides a safe and solid platform for workers to perform tasks at heights. There are several vital components that contribute to the overall stability of a scaffold structure. Among these are towers, boards, and ladders.

Towers form the base of a scaffold, providing a vertical framework for attaching other components. They come in different heights and configurations to accommodate different project needs. Boards, also known as planks or platforms, are attached to the towers and provide a level surface for workers to stand and perform their duties. These boards must be durable enough to support the weight of workers and materials.

Ladders are an vital part of scaffolding, providing access to and from the working platform. They must be in good condition to ensure worker safety.

Scaffold Board Safety: Best Practices for Secure Working Platforms

Using secure scaffold boards is crucial for any construction or maintenance task that requires working at heights. Examining your scaffold boards before each use can help prevent accidents and ensure a safe work environment. Always choose platforms in good condition, free from cracks, splits, or other weakness.

Make sure the scaffold is securely assembled and properly anchored. Use appropriate safety systems to prevent falls. Never overload scaffold boards beyond their weight capacity.

Additionally, keep your work area organized and free of hazards. Always wear get more info suitable personal protective equipment, including a hardhat and safety glasses.

Remember to follow all OSHA's safety guidelines and regulations when working on scaffold boards.

Selecting Scaffold Ladders Safely

Reaching new heights on construction sites demands reliable and safe equipment. When it comes to scaffolding ladders, picking the right one is crucial for confirming worker security. A ladder that's sturdy and appropriately sized for the job can prevent falls.

Ahead of you acquire a scaffold ladder, analyze these key aspects:

* **Work Height:**

The ladder must extend at least two feet above your maximum point.

* **Load Capacity:**

Make sure the ladder can hold the weight of you, your tools, and any potential pressures.

* **Ladder Type:**

There are various types of scaffold ladders, featuring single-section, multi-section, and telescopic ladders. Each type has its own advantages and limitations.

* **Material:**

Ladders are typically made from aluminum. Aluminum is lightweight and rust-resistant, while steel is more durable.

Bear in thought that safety should always be your top concern. Inspect your ladder frequently for any damage, and never use a damaged ladder.
